Summary: Add the default value for configuration property
ozone.om.kerberos.principal to support cross realm

When issuing Ozone commands across clusters in different Kerberos realm, it
produces the following error:
{noformat}
# hdfs dfs -ls ofs://ozone1707264383/
24/02/07 18:47:36 INFO retry.RetryInvocationHandler:
com.google.protobuf.ServiceException: java.io.IOException: DestHost:destPort
ccycloud-1.weichiu-dst.root.comops.site:9862 , LocalHost:localPort
ccycloud-1.weichiu-src.local/10.140.99.144:0. Failed on local exception:
java.io.IOException: Couldn't set up IO streams:
java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Server has invalid Kerberos principal:
om/[email protected], expecting:
OM/ccycloud-1.weichiu-dst.local@REALM, while invoking $Proxy10.submitRequest
over nodeId=om26,nodeAddress=ccycloud-1.weichiu-dst.local:9862 after 3 failover
attempts. Trying to failover immediately.
{noformat}
This is because ozone.om.kerberos.principal is not defined properly.
On the contrary, HDFS does not have this issue because HDFS-7546 already added
the default value for dfs.namenode.kerberos.principal.pattern which is wildcard.
We should do the same for ozone.om.kerberos.principal.
